你查询的IP:[116.4.206.225]  地理位置:中国–广东–东莞

最新查询60.255.92.136 116.70.114.188 123.244.61.213 119.40.27.144 119.3.68.200 119.42.167.234 116.204.56.129 221.198.41.144 125.171.144.83 116.4.206.225 123.108.128.18 192.188.170.198 125.208.93.6 222.128.120.151 121.248.90.191 125.171.28.82 61.4.176.105 202.38.150.206 114.28.228.249 117.53.48.10 118.102.16.180 120.30.228.237 202.75.208.107 168.160.5.91 192.83.122.63 116.255.128.22 203.99.16.188 117.57.56.65 202.136.208.72 202.249.176.219 118.184.179.219